I ordered the "ring-tub", which I thought was a balance ring. (D'oh!). When checking out, Appliance Parts Pros suggested two other items: the suspension rod kit, and tub centering springs. Based on their suggestion, I also ordered the suspension rod kit and two 2-packs of the tub centering springs. I doubled up on the tub centering springs after reading a submission on their website by a previous DIY'r. In replacing these parts, I was surprised to see that there were NO tub centering springs installed on my washer! I can't believe it functioned for 5 years without them. The suspension spring must have weakened, resulting in the violent shaking. I installed all 4 tub centering springs, the 4 new suspension rods/springs, and the tub ring. (The old/original ring was chipped badly from the shaking.) It's only been a few days since the repair, but we've done a number of wash loads of varying size, and there has been no shaking whatsoever.
